  • Fridge Brilliance: In The Tribe, Chris & Nicole's aunt doesn't give them many rules, but tells them she'll kick them out if all they do is party, flipping out at them at the end of the film because she thinks that's what they have been doing. The first impression is that she's unreasonably strict (Chris over 18, and Nicole's guardian), but the police station has a wall literally covered in missing person posters, most of them the age of Chris & Nicole. She's not being strict, she's fully aware that in the town, a lot of teenagers have gone to parties but never returned home.
